Here are some instructions to do a massive Bob release and scripts to help you
release Bob:
Create a buildout configuration file that checks out all packages from
`bob.nightlies`. Here is an example:

List and order of packages come from bob.nightlies; in `core.txt` and
`extra.txt`. Don't forget to add `bob` after `core.txt`.
Create a conda environment with `bob-devel`:
$ conda create -n bob-devel-27 python=2 bob-devel
You should not install any other package and run:
$ buildout
$ bin/nosetests -sv src/*
Make sure all the tests are passing.
Go through all packages and write down what has changed since their last
tag and write it down into a file (`changelog.md` for example). Here is an
example:
bob.extension (Minor)
* !37 !38 !39 !41 : Improved documentation for a better development guide
* !42 : Improve the new version script in terms of functionality and documentation
bob.blitz (Patch)
* Maintenance release.
**This is the most important part!!!!** Do not write this changelog easily.
You really have to dig through the history of all packages since the last
release. Write down what has changed by not copying and pasting.
Changelogs are read by humans and must be generated by humans.
PROPERLY identify if a package needs a patch, minor, or a major release bump.
See http://semver.org for information. Ask the package's maintainer if you are
not sure.
Then you can use `release.sh` and modify its release list depending on what you
have in your `changelog.md`. Some packages need a patch release and some need a
minor release and some a major release.
Hold off `bob` for now.
Don't release private packages!
Read bin/bob_new_version.py --help
Run that script. Release the first package. Wait for its CI to finish. Merge
its merge request on bob.conda. wait for that to finish in master of bob.conda.
Press `y` to go to the next package.
Finally read `bob` s readme and release that too.
You are done here no need to read the rest of this file.
You may want to disable the runners for bob.conda so that you can run it once
everything is merged into master. To merge everything and cancel all pipelines
in bob.conda. Read here:
https://python-gitlab.readthedocs.io/en/stable/index.html
Then:

This will merge all merge requests. But sometimes the branch is created but
there is no merge request for that. Merge those branches manually! and cancel
the pipelines again.
Run the pipeline for master of bob.conda once and fix till every conda package
is released.
Release `bob`. Here is some code to get the changelog generated automatically
for bob:
